This role primarily involves supporting administrative activities while working closely with the HR Ops team on onboarding, coordination, and documentation as needed. You will play a key part in ensuring smooth HR processes, timely task execution, and a well-organized employee experience.
What you will do:
-
Assist with daily HR operations and administrative tasks.
-
Coordinate employee onboarding and exit formalities.
-
Manage employee transportation requirements.
-
Handle ID card applications, issuance, and follow-ups.
-
Monitor and replenish office supplies as needed.
-
Maintain employee databases and update HRMS records.
-
Work with the HR Ops team on offer releases and documentation.
-
Support internal teams with HR-related coordination.
-
Prepare reports, maintain trackers, and manage HR documentation.
-
Take on additional tasks for exposure and learning across HR functions.
